The NI PCI-6542 is a high-speed digital waveform generator and analyzer that delivers precise timing and synchronization for stimulus-response testing, digital communication protocols, and custom signal analysis. The card provides 32 single-ended digital I/O channels with per-channel programmable direction control, operating at a maximum sample clock rate of 100 MHz across configurable logic levels of 5.0 V, 3.3 V, 2.5 V, and 1.8 V. Deep onboard memory leverages Synchronization and Memory Core (SMC) technology, enabling waveforms and instructions to occupy shared memory in 1 MB, 8 MB, or 64 MB per-channel configurations. This architecture supports both single waveform modes and scripted sequences, with advanced triggering and pattern sequencing capabilities for low-skew multichannel synchronization across multiple devices. The included Digital Waveform Editor provides an interactive design environment with support for ASCII and VCD format imports, alongside built-in PRBS and count patterns. Hardware integration occurs through the NI-HSDIO driver on a standard PCI interface.
– Technical Specifications
• Channels: 32 single-ended digital I/O with per-channel direction control
• Sample Clock Rate: 100 MHz maximum
• Onboard Memory: 1 MB, 8 MB, or 64 MB per channel (configurable)
• Memory Architecture: Synchronization and Memory Core (SMC) with shared waveform and instruction storage
• Logic Levels: 5.0 V, 3.3 V, 2.5 V, 1.8 V (configurable via NI-HSDIO driver)
• Clock Accuracy: ±100 ppm frequency accuracy; ±30 ppm temperature stability; ±5 ppm aging (first year)
• Power: +3.3 V DC at 1.6 A typical / 1.8 A maximum; +5 V DC at 1.2 A
• Waveform Resolution: Integer multiple of 2 samples minimum
– Key Features
• Per-channel programmable I/O direction for flexible signal routing
• Dual waveform generation modes: single execution (once, n times, or continuous) and scripted sequences
• Advanced pattern triggering with sequencing logic
• Built-in pattern generation: PRBS and count up/down sequences
• Digital Waveform Editor with VCD and ASCII import capability
– Typical Applications
• Stimulus-response testing in digital systems
• Protocol analysis and custom digital signal generation
• Mixed-signal test system development
• Low-skew multichannel digital synchronization
– Compatibility & Integration
• PCI interface with NI-HSDIO driver support
• Digital Waveform Editor included with 8 MB and 64 MB configurations
